I know the 6G is 2" wider than the 5G, but wondered if that meant that the bed rails are farther apart. On my 5G they are 55 1/2 inches (141 cm).

I'm wondering if I could use my crossover toolbox with a Thule ladder rack on a 6G. The bed rails would only need to be about 1 inch (wider 2.54cm) for it to work. About 56 1/2 inches or 143.5cm

I realize the ROW trucks could be a little different than the US version I'd et, but if someone currently has a 6G and could measure, it'd be appreciated.
